Apache NiFi for Developers Schulung

Kurs Code

nifidev

Dauer

7 hours (üblicherweise 1 Tag inklusive Pausen)

Voraussetzungen

  • Java programming experience.
  • Experience with Maven.

Audience

  • Developers
  • Data engineers

Überblick

Apache NiFi (Hortonworks DataFlow) ist eine integrierte Datenlogistik- und einfache Ereignisverarbeitungsplattform in Echtzeit, die das Verschieben, Verfolgen und Automatisieren von Daten zwischen Systemen ermöglicht. Es wurde unter Verwendung von Flow-basierter Programmierung geschrieben und bietet eine webbasierte Benutzeroberfläche zum Verwalten von Datenflüssen in Echtzeit.

In diesem von Lehrern geführten Live-Training lernen die Teilnehmer die Grundlagen der Flow-basierten Programmierung kennen, während sie mit Apache NiFi eine Reihe von Demo-Erweiterungen, Komponenten und Prozessoren Apache NiFi .

Am Ende dieser Schulung können die Teilnehmer:

  • Verstehen Sie die Architektur und die Datenflusskonzepte von NiFi.
  • Entwickeln Sie Erweiterungen mit NiFi und APIs von Drittanbietern.
  • Entwickeln Sie Ihren eigenen Apache Nifi Prozessor.
  • Erfassen und verarbeiten Sie Echtzeitdaten aus unterschiedlichen und ungewöhnlichen Dateiformaten und Datenquellen.

Format des Kurses

  • Interaktiver Vortrag und Diskussion.
  • Viele Übungen und Übungen.
  • Praktische Implementierung in einer Live-Laborumgebung.

Anpassungsoptionen für den Kurs

  • Um ein individuelles Training für diesen Kurs anzufordern, kontaktieren Sie uns bitte, um dies zu arrangieren.

Machine Translated

Schulungsübersicht

Introduction

  • Data at rest vs data in motion

Overview of Big Data Tools and Technologies

  • Hadoop (HDFS and MapReduce) and Spark

Installing and Configuring NiFi

Overview of NiFi Architecture

Development Approaches

  • Application development tools and mindset
  • Extract, Transform, and Load (ETL) tools and mindset

Design Considerations

Components, Events, and Processor Patterns

Exercise: Streaming Data Feeds into HDFS

Error Handling

Controller Services

Exercise: Ingesting Data from IoT Devices using Web-Based APIs

Exercise: Developing a Custom Apache Nifi Processor using JSON

Testing and Troubleshooting

Contributing to Apache NiFi

Summary and Conclusion

Erfahrungsberichte

★★★★★
★★★★★

Verwandte Kategorien

EINIGE UNSERER KUNDEN

is growing fast!

We are looking to expand our presence in Germany!

As a Business Development Manager you will:

  • expand business in Germany
  • recruit local talent (sales, agents, trainers, consultants)
  • recruit local trainers and consultants

We offer:

  • Artificial Intelligence and Big Data systems to support your local operation
  • high-tech automation
  • continuously upgraded course catalogue and content
  • good fun in international team

If you are interested in running a high-tech, high-quality training and consulting business.

Apply now!